Is the art show circuit still a viable way to sell art?

The art show circuit has become increasingly problematic and shows signs of permanent decline. You pay for booth space, spend eight or more hours on your feet, and there’s no guarantee you’ll be profitable after expenses. The ROI is often low even in good times. With recent disruptions, many artists report the show circuit simply isn’t coming back to previous levels, and health concerns make the future uncertain. Meanwhile, shows don’t help you build lasting customer relationships—you don’t keep contact information, and you can’t effectively follow up. The time and money invested often doesn’t justify the return compared to building your own online presence.
